Transaction ed31b98f98c4de2992e7127f87d9f6e5be5798399384bd353bd4aaefdd5e90ca
2 Input
2 Outputs
- ed31b98f98c4de2992e7127f87d9f6e5be5798399384bd353bd4aaefdd5e90ca:0
- ed31b98f98c4de2992e7127f87d9f6e5be5798399384bd353bd4aaefdd5e90ca:1
value 100000000
address 187hNXKK8XHnSWfBXEpTC4gYgvNE5mz5pc
value 308914090
address 32qpvpX9DuefqGFmw9h6MJS95fgAP4w2gq